For our 200th podcast, we're covering "The Simpsons", a superlative satirical juggernaut that, for over 35 years, has held a yellow mirror up to our absurd world. Filled with endlessly quotable moments, pitch-perfect vocal performances, and expertly incisive comedy, Matt Groening's brainchild may arguably be the single greatest television show ever made, and easily one of the most important artistic works of all time. We're joined by four cromulent guests, improviser Dan Oster (MadTV, "A Podcast, But Evil"), comedian / musician Dylan Ris (www.lostmoonradio.com, www.themoonunits.com), comedian Rich Baker, and singer Sophie Gonzalez (also www.themoonunits.com).
